We’re big fans of Heritage Radio Network. The Bushwick-based radio station broadcasts from Roberta’s and, like us, has a big heart for celebrating the best food and drink that our borough has to offer. As we’ve done for past issues, we bring you a roundup of Heritage shows that showcase some of the subjects from our current summer issue.

Want to hear the farmers, bakers and cheese makers speak for themselves? Consider these shows while you stream a podcast at work, at home or on the go:

Urban Cheese Making with Matt Speigler: Cutting the Curd, Episode 96Play episode
Anne Saxelby and Sophie Slesinger talk with Matt Spiegler: web developer by day, and cheese maker by night. Tune in to hear Matt’s first memories of cheese, his initial interest in making his own cheese and what types of cheeses he prefers to make.

Good Eggs NYC: HRN Community Sessions, Episode 159Play episode
Josh Morgenthau speaks with hosts Eddie Shumard and Erin Fairbanks about Good Eggs NYC, an online grocery store that aims to bring local groceries right to your door or through pickup. By supporting small producers and local brands, Good Eggs’ mission is to grow and sustain local food systems worldwide through better eating, sourcing straight from farmers markets and butcher shops and caring for the environment.

Van Brunt Stillhouse: The Speakeasy, Episode 62Play episode
Damon Boelte chats with friend and distiller at Van Brunt Stillhouse, Daric Schlesselman about what it’s like to run a small batch distillery and how grappa got him into this whole business.

Brooklyn Grange: Rooftop Farming With Ben FlannerPlay episode
You’re in luck if you want to hear more from Brooklyn Grange — they have a series of over 30 shows! We chose this one on honey in anticipation of they upcoming honey week events, which you can read more about in our September events calendar.

Four & Twenty Blackbirds: Eat Your Words, Episode 102Play episode
Emily and Melissa Elsen of Four & Twenty Blackbirds join hostess Cathy Erway in the studio on this episode of Let’s Eat In. Learn about the pie-making roots of the Elsen sisters and their dedication to baking with seasonal ingredients.
